有一個學生的結構如下

struct Student {

   int grade[20];

   int count;

};

grade 陣列裡儲存的是每位學生的成績, count 裡儲存的是該位學生共修習多少科目,請用這個結構實作以下函數。

int average_grade(struct Student s);

該函數傳入一個學生的結構,然後計算出該學生的平均後回傳。
